New Jackar 34mm f/1.8 MFT lens.

Share

The Hong Kong located company Jackar Optical just announced a new 34mm f/1.8 Micro Four Thirds lens. The lens has manual and mechanical smooth focus and aperture rings. You can read full specs and more at Snapshooter.jackarlens.com. Image samples can also be found on Flickr. The retail price is $190. It will soon be on sale on eBay. Jackar currently sells many adapters and fisheye lenses on [shoplink 35027 ebay]eBay (Click here)[/shoplink]. For a $190 this looks like a well packaged present!

And our reader Twills sent me this: “The Panasonic GH3 specs page is being constantly updated as the firmware is finalized. The shutter duration spec did not specify a “Bulb” mode time limit before. Now it says it goes up to Approx. 60 minutes. That is great news as the GH2 is limited to 128 seconds in Bulb mode:
Still Images: 1/4,000 – 60 and Bulb (Approx. 60 minutes)
Motion Images: 1/16,000 – 1/30 (NTSC), 1/16,000 – 1/25 (PAL)
